Understanding Forex Market Hours
First off, let's demystify Forex market hours. Unlike your local stock exchange with fixed timings, the Forex market operates 24 hours a day, five days a week. This continuous trading is possible because the market is decentralized with major financial centers around the globe. When one market closes, another opens, keeping the cycle going. Understanding these sessions is crucial because each has its unique characteristics. For example, the London session often sees the highest trading volume due to its overlap with other European markets and the start of the New York session. The Tokyo session might be quieter but can still present opportunities in specific currency pairs involving the Japanese Yen.
The magic happens during the overlaps, especially between London and New York. This is when you see the highest liquidity and the tightest spreads, making it an ideal time for executing trades. Missing these peak hours means potentially missing out on the best market conditions. So, keeping an eye on a Forex market open time countdown becomes incredibly valuable.
Moreover, different currency pairs are more active during specific sessions. For instance, AUD/USD sees more action during the Sydney and early Tokyo sessions, while EUR/USD and GBP/USD are most active during the London and New York sessions. Knowing these nuances allows you to focus your trading efforts on the right pairs at the right times, increasing your chances of success.
Why Timing is Crucial in Forex Trading
Timing is everything in Forex trading, guys. It's not just about when the market opens, but also understanding the ebbs and flows of trading activity. The opening hours of each major session often see a surge in volatility as new information hits the market and traders react. This can create opportunities for quick profits, but also poses risks if you're not prepared.
The initial volatility can set the tone for the rest of the trading day. Smart traders use this period to gauge market sentiment and identify potential trends. For example, if a currency pair shows strong bullish momentum during the opening hour of the London session, it might signal a continuation of the trend throughout the day. However, it's also essential to be wary of false breakouts and market manipulation, which can occur during these volatile periods.
Having a Forex market open time countdown helps you prepare for these critical moments. It allows you to analyze your charts, review your trading plan, and be ready to execute trades when the market conditions align with your strategy. Without this preparation, you might find yourself reacting impulsively to market movements, which can lead to costly mistakes. Furthermore, understanding the timing helps you manage your risk more effectively. By knowing when volatility is likely to increase, you can adjust your stop-loss orders and position sizes to protect your capital.
Another reason timing is vital is the impact of economic news releases. Major economic announcements, such as GDP figures, employment data, and interest rate decisions, are typically released at specific times, often coinciding with the opening of a major trading session. These announcements can trigger significant market movements, creating opportunities for informed traders. A Forex market open time countdown can be synced with an economic calendar to ensure you're aware of these potential market-moving events.

Tools for Tracking Market Open Times
Alright, so you're convinced that a Forex market open time countdown is essential. But where do you find one? Luckily, there are tons of tools available to help you track market open times.
One of the easiest ways to track market open times is by using online Forex calendars. Numerous websites offer these calendars, and they typically include countdowns to the opening of major market sessions. Some popular options include Bloomberg, Reuters, and ForexFactory. These calendars provide a wealth of information, including the dates and times of economic news releases, holidays, and other important events that could impact the market.
Another option is to use the built-in countdown timers that are available on some trading platforms. These timers show the time remaining until the next market open, making it easy to stay informed. Some popular trading platforms with built-in countdown timers include MetaTrader 4 and MetaTrader 5. Finally, if you're always on the go, you might want to consider using a mobile app to track market open times. Several mobile apps provide real-time market hours and countdowns, allowing you to stay informed no matter where you are. Some popular options include Investing.com and Forex Hours.
